[ 5h0ck @ 15.11.2014. 15:31 ] @
Pozdrav svima,

Iako imam višegodišnje iskustvo u radu sa internetom i programskim jezicima, nikada nisam mogao da u potpunosti sklopim kockice vezano za pojmove navedene u naslovu teme. Pretpostavljam da je razlog tome što nisam bio u kontaktu sa ljudima koji bi mi odgovorili na sva moja pitanja.
Shvatam IP adrese, povezivanje domena, propagaciju DNS-ova... Čaprkao sam po WHM-u neke stvari, konfigurisao server na DigitalOcean-u i podigao virtualmin/webmin, čaprkao i po tome, iako mi pregršt opcija tamo nisu jasne.
Pročitao sam dosta članaka na netu, ali mi nijedan nije sklopio kockice, pa se nadam da će se ovde neko naći i pomoći mi u tome.

Zakupio sam virtualni hosting CentOS 6 64bit.
Zakupio sam i 3 ip adrese.
Prilikom instalacije WHM-a, prateći neko uputstvo sa interneta definisao sam neke nameservere. Mnoge hosting kompanije imaju 2 nameservera, npr:
ns1.hostingserver.com
ns2.hostingserver.com
Oba imaju različitu IP adresu! Zašto? Znam i da ne moraju da imaju. Čemu služi jedna, a čemu druga?
Drugo pitanje: Ako neka hosting kompanija svoj sajt predstavlja recimo pod domenom hosting.com, zašto njihovi nameserveri nisu nsX.hosting.com, nego drugačiji. I to što je drugačije, da li je to dodatno zakupljeni domen? (logično mi je da jeste, ali moram da pitam)

Uglavnom, završio sam setup za WHM i osnovni domen i sve radi.
Potom sam dodao novi domen (novidomen.com).
Prema zahtevu klijenta, tražio je da taj domen bude pod drugom IP adresom. Neko mu je tako rekao.
Definisao sam nove namservere nsX.novidomen.com i jednom i drugom sam dodelio treću IP adresu.
Radilo je.
Radi trenutno sada, ali smo primetili da sajt s vremena na vreme postaje nedostupan.
Server je bio ispravan, bez padova, proverio sam.
Koristeći neke online alate za proveru domena (pingdom), ustanovio sam da imam neke probleme sa domenom.
Sledeće greške su se pojavile:
Citat:
Failed to find name servers of novidomen.com/IN.

A sajt se normalno prikazuje u browseru.
Citat:
No name servers found at child.
No name servers could be found at the child. This usually means that the child is not configured to answer queries about the zone.

Citat:
Not enough nameserver information was found to test the zone novidomen.com, but an IP address lookup succeeded in spite of that.


Nijedan od ovih problema mi nije jasan. Iskreno, nisam siguran ni gde bih šta probao da menjam.
Imam neki Client Area gde kupujem domene i hostinge, ali su tamo opcije jako jednostavne.

Zaista bih bio zahvalan na svakoj pomoći.
[ Aleksandar Đokić @ 15.11.2014. 19:31 ] @
Citat:
Oba imaju različitu IP adresu! Zašto? Znam i da ne moraju da imaju. Čemu služi jedna, a čemu druga?


Komplikujes, to su dns serveri na kojima se nalaze zone (autoritativni) za domene koje hostuju (a mogu da sluze i kao resolveri nekim lokalnim mrezama za druge domene). Postoje dva (ili vise) iskljucivo iz razloga redundanse i load balansinga, inace mogao bi da radi i jedan sasvim dobro (dok broj dns zahteva nije veci nego sto taj server moze da izdrzi).

Imaju dve IP adrese jer su u pitanju razliciti serveri (sto je i logicno), a sve u cilju fail-over-a.

Citat:
zašto njihovi nameserveri nisu nsX.hosting.com, nego drugačiji


Potpuno nebitno koji hostname se koristi za adresu servera. Bitno je da moze da se razresi na pravu IP adresu, i da kod registra ti dns serveri budu autoritativni za taj domen (negde je zakupljen "hosting.com" i kod njih mora da stoji na kom dns-u je zona za "hosting.com")

Citat:
dodao sam osnovni domen, potom sam dodao novi domen (novidomen.com) prema zahtevu klijenta, tražio je da taj domen bude pod drugom IP adresom, definisao sam nove namservere nsX.novidomen.com i jednom i drugom sam dodelio treću IP adresu.



To je ok, ali za te domene kod registra je neophodno da postavis dns na "nsX.novidomen.com". Proveri u WHM-u da li u DNS-u postoje zone za oba domena i koji su A zapisi. Inace nisi imao potrebe za razlicitim IP-jevima.